top of page

Ada pertanyaan lain?

Thanks for submitting!

©2023 by Felicia Lentera Cloud Administrator
Excellence in Learning and Teaching Center
Petra Christian University

LOGO (2).png

+62 895 0118 2795

Kantor ELTC UK Petra (Ruang B.107)

@eltcpcu

bottom of page